Mangalore Refinery and Petrochemicals Limited

Meeting Details

The 38th Annual General Meeting of Mangalore Refinery and Petrochemicals Limited was held on Monday, August 24, 2026, through Video Conferencing (VC) or Other Audio-Visual Means (OAVM). The meeting transacted all businesses as set out in the Notice of AGM dated July 15, 2026.

Remote E-Voting Period

The remote e-voting period commenced on Friday, August 21, 2026, at 09:00 A.M. and ended on Sunday, August 23, 2026, at 05:00 P.M. The NSDL e-voting platform was blocked fifteen minutes after the conclusion of the AGM.

Scrutinizer Appointment

Naresh Kumar Sinha, Practicing Company Secretary and proprietor of Kumar Naresh Sinha & Associates, was appointed as Scrutinizer to scrutinize the process of remote electronic voting and e-voting during the AGM.

Resolution 9: Approval of Material Related Party Transactions with Shell MRPL Aviation
  • Type: Ordinary Resolution
  • Result: Passed with requisite majority
  • Total Votes Polled: 40,494,931
  • Votes in Favor: 32,922,551 (81.30%)
  • Votes Against: 7,572,380 (18.70%)
  • Number of Voters: 724 (675 assent, 49 dissent)
  • Transaction Details: Material Related Party Transactions for Aviation Turbine Fuel etc., with Shell MRPL Aviation Fuels and Services Limited for an amount up to ₹5,500 Crore for Financial Year 2027-28
  • Material Threshold: Transactions exceed the material threshold of ₹4,627.88 crore calculated under SEBI's scale-based framework
Resolution 10: Amendment in Object Clause and Adoption of Memorandum & Articles of Association
  • Type: Special Resolution
  • Result: Passed with requisite majority
  • Voting Details: Specific vote counts not provided in scrutinizer's report, but resolution was passed
  • Amendments Include:
  • Expansion of main objects to include manufacturing of Active Pharma Intermediates (API's), Biofuels, Renewable, Green Energy and other sustainable technologies
  • Reorganization of Object Clause to align with Companies Act, 2013 structure
  • Updating Articles of Association to conform with Companies Act, 2013 provisions
  • Automatic substitution of references to 'Companies Act, 1956' with corresponding provisions of 'Companies Act, 2013'
